嘿,朋友!今天我想和你聊聊我最近的一个新爱好——区块链游戏搭建。说实话,我并不是计算机专业出身,最开始也对这种高大上的东西有点畏惧。但是,机缘巧合下,我接触到了这个领域,自此便一发不可收拾。
在过去的几年里,区块链的概念一直在耳边萦绕,尤其是在朋友们讨论投资和加密货币的时候。直到有一天,我看到一个朋友在玩一款区块链游戏,不仅可以玩,还能通过游戏赚到真金白银,甚至获取各种NFT(非同质化代币)!
天哪,瞬间激起了我的好奇心。玩游戏还能赚钱?这是什么神仙操作?这一点让我深深扎根在了这个领域。之后,我就开始研究,了解区块链的基础知识,以及如何搭建自己的游戏。
刚开始的时候,我其实什么都不懂。什么是区块链、智能合约,甚至连最简单的编程语言都不太会。这时候我想:难道就此止步?不行!我决定通过看视频、加入论坛、参加学习群来进行自我学习。
让我感到幸运的是,现在有很多在线课程和开源资源,帮助我们这些新手入门。通过这些教程,我慢慢掌握了一些基础知识,甚至尝试自己写些简单的智能合约。最初的几次编译错误让我咬牙切齿,但我知道这是成长的必经之路嘛!
在掌握了一些基本知识后,我开始考虑具体的游戏搭建。我咨询了一些圈内的朋友,得知 Unity 是一个很不错的选择,特别是对于像我这样的新手。Unity 界面友好,社区也很活跃,许多资源都可以直接使用。
于是我就开始在 Unity 上搭建我的第一款游戏——一个简单的角色扮演游戏。你知道的,过于复杂的东西一开始就容易让人打退堂鼓。我选择的只是一些简单的机制,比如角色移动、打怪等。然后把这个游戏和区块链技术结合起来。简单来说,就是在游戏内添加一些基于以太坊的交易功能,让玩家可以通过打怪获得代币。
说到设计游戏玩法,我花了许多时间来琢磨玩家的需求。哪些玩法让他们乐在其中?其实我从我自己作为玩家的角度出发,试图设计出更有吸引力的机制。
比如,我注意到人们都喜欢升级、变强。于是我在游戏中设置了一些难度逐渐递增的关卡,让刚开始的玩家能够轻松上手,但越到后面,敌人越强大,需求的代币越多。这样一来,玩家的投入和回报就形成了一种良性互动,简直就是“沉浸式体验”嘛!
当我把游戏的基本框架搭建完毕后,一个大难题摆在我面前:如何安全地实现区块链交易?这就涉及到智能合约的编写了。
我开始深入学习 Solidity(以太坊的编程语言),这是一项不小的挑战。以自己的方式解决问题成了每天的日常。我反复试错,甚至有时候测试时简直想要放弃,心里暗想:“我真的能做到吗?”
但随着一点点进步,我逐渐理解了智能合约的逻辑,学会了如何为玩家的每一次交易、每一个游戏事件设计合约。这种成就感简直太棒了!
游戏初步搭建之后,我心里充满了期待,决定找一些朋友来测试一下。其实我有点紧张,毕竟我花了这么多心血,希望他们能喜欢。然而,测试后得到的反馈并不全是我期望的,甚至有不少问题需要修改。
朋友们提出的建议让我意识到,别人的角度总是不同的。有些玩法太复杂,有些操作不够流畅。我就像是被打击了一样,但回过头想想,正是这些反馈才让我有机会去完善我的项目。
就这样,我反复和我的小伙伴们沟通,听取各种反馈,调整。经过几轮测试,游戏变得越来越好。我真的很感激那些愿意帮我测试的朋友,因为没有他们的帮助,这个游戏也许还停留在初步阶段。
终于,我的区块链游戏第一次上线了!那感觉真是不可思议,虽说只是个小项目,但我已经满心欢喜。接下来就是推广了,我认真想了想,我需要找到目标用户,到底谁是我的玩家?
通过社交媒体、群组甚至论坛,我开始主动宣传。在一次次的分享中,逐渐吸引到了一些好奇的玩家。虽然最开始不温不火,但随着时间的推移,流量逐步上升,玩家开始为了获取游戏代币和稀有装备而积极参与。
发布后,很多人以为我可以松一口气了,殊不知这才是漫长旅程的开始。玩家的反馈让我意识到,游戏的内容和机制需要不断调整和迭代。每次新增的功能都有可能带来新的问题,而持久留住玩家才是我的目标。
于是,我不断收集玩家的意见,像做好饭菜那样,逐渐调整游戏体验。难度、奖励、玩法……等等,甚至还加入一些节日活动,增加游戏的趣味性。
这段时间,我从一个对区块链一知半解的小白,变成了一名游戏搭建者,虽说是小有成就,但感受到的快乐和挑战都是无法用金钱来衡量的。
我想告诉你们的是,玩转区块链游戏并不是遥不可及的梦想。只要你愿意学习、探索,朝着方向努力,就一定会找到属于自己的那片天地。不管你是否有技术背景,只要你对这个领域充满热情,就能够在这个快速发展的行业中找到自己的位置。
希望我的分享能给你带来一点启发,或许下一个区块链游戏的搭建者,明天就会是你!